Navigating the Shadows: The Intriguing World of Stealth Startups

In the ever-evolving landscape of entrepreneurship, a unique and mysterious phenomenon has captured the imagination of innovators and investors alike—the Stealth Startup. Operating in the shadows, shielded from the spotlight, these clandestine ventures embark on a journey of secrecy, strategically concealing their activities until the opportune moment. In this article, we delve into the intriguing world of stealth startups, exploring their characteristics, reasons for operating in stealth mode, and the challenges and advantages associated with this enigmatic approach to business development.

Unraveling the Stealth Startup Phenomenon

1. The Veil of Secrecy:

  • Stealth startups are characterized by their deliberate decision to operate in secrecy during their early stages. This means keeping crucial details about their products, services, and sometimes even their existence, under wraps.

2. Limited Public Presence:

  • Unlike traditional startups that actively engage with the public through marketing, social media, and press releases, stealth startups maintain a minimal public presence. Their websites may offer cryptic information or, in some cases, remain completely offline.

3. Strategic Confidentiality:

  • The decision to remain stealth is strategic, often driven by the desire to shield innovative ideas, proprietary technologies, or unique business models from competitors. This confidentiality allows stealth startups to work on their projects without external interference or premature scrutiny.

4. Timing is Everything:

  • Stealth startups carefully time their emergence from the shadows. The goal is to make a significant impact when they do reveal themselves, creating a buzz in the market and capturing the attention of potential investors, partners, and customers.

Reasons for Operating in Stealth Mode

1. Intellectual Property Protection:

  • One of the primary reasons for choosing stealth mode is to safeguard intellectual property. By keeping innovations hidden, startups can prevent competitors from gaining insights into their unique technologies or business methods.

2. Competitive Advantage:

  • Operating in stealth allows startups to maintain a competitive advantage. By avoiding premature exposure, they can fine-tune their offerings, differentiate themselves, and strategically position their products or services in the market.

3. Investor Appeal:

  • Stealth startups often generate heightened interest from investors due to the air of mystery surrounding their projects. This intrigue can lead to increased attention and potential funding opportunities when they decide to reveal their endeavors.

4. Unbiased Market Feedback:

  • By remaining incognito, startups can gather unbiased market feedback during their development phase. This enables them to refine their products or services based on real-world insights before facing the scrutiny of a wider audience.

Challenges and Advantages of Stealth Startups

Challenges:

  1. Limited Visibility:
    • Operating in stealth means limited visibility, making it challenging to build brand awareness or attract early adopters who could provide valuable feedback.
  2. Secrecy Strain:
    • Maintaining secrecy can be mentally and operationally challenging for the team, as they must be cautious about what information is shared both internally and externally.

Advantages:

  1. Intellectual Property Protection:
    • Securing intellectual property is a significant advantage, preventing competitors from replicating or adapting innovative solutions.
  2. Strategic Impact:
    • When a stealth startup eventually reveals its existence, the strategic impact can be substantial. The element of surprise often generates buzz and curiosity in the market.
  3. Enhanced Investor Interest:
    • Stealth mode can attract investors who are intrigued by the unknown and are more willing to invest in projects with a sense of mystery and potential.
  4. Refined Product Development:
    • Operating discreetly allows startups to refine their products or services without external pressure, ensuring a more polished offering when they enter the public domain.

The Unveiling: Transitioning from Stealth to Spotlight

1. Strategic Timing:

  • The transition from stealth to the spotlight is a carefully orchestrated move. Startups choose a strategic moment to reveal themselves, often aligning with product readiness, market conditions, or funding milestones.

2. Buzz Creation:

  • To make a memorable entrance, stealth startups focus on creating a buzz. This involves leveraging marketing strategies, engaging with the media, and showcasing the unique aspects of their offerings.

3. Stakeholder Engagement:

  • As the veil lifts, startups actively engage with stakeholders—customers, partners, and the broader community. This engagement is crucial for building relationships, gaining traction, and sustaining momentum.
